Why did ancient biblical authors quote from texts missing from your Bible today? The Book of Jasher in Joshua 10:12-13 often brings up honest questions. We see Joshua fighting at Beth-horon, and later David mourning Saul and Jonathan in 2 Samuel 1:18-27, both pointing to this mysterious text of ancient Hebrew songs. It is completely normal to ask why the Holy Spirit guided these leaders to cite an outside source.
